The Language Encounter in the Americas, 1492-1800 - European Expansion & Global Interaction
The Language Encounter in the Americas, 1492-1800 - European Expansion & Global Interaction
For the first time, historians, anthropologists, literature specialists, and linguists have come together to reflect, in the fifteen original essays presented in this volume, on the various modes of contact and communication that took place between the Europeans and the "Natives."
